Output 66c5e1b75201b7baeb8dc6bf5cb478e9e384bcfa9e926eab8a3a65cf8983af5a:0

value
1678468
script pubkey
OP_0 OP_PUSHBYTES_20 80fabf14b670b439f3f9aa63ac346db234ec63cd
address
bc1qsrat799kwz6rnule4f36cdrdkg6wcc7dkc4zxs
transaction
66c5e1b75201b7baeb8dc6bf5cb478e9e384bcfa9e926eab8a3a65cf8983af5a
spent
true